The Sputnik program was a series of robotic spacecraft missions launched by the Soviet Union. The first of these, Sputnik 1, launched the first human-made object to orbit the Earth.
The first artificial satellite was Sputnik I, launched by the Soviet Union on the 4th of October 1957

The satellite that carried the first television signal across the ocean was called Telstar. The first Telstar satellite was launched in 1962.
